Transaction 525e87301bb5b9133396d72ee1f4f95032e9b76f0c84a984f6814e81c8dfed11
1 Input
1 Output
-
525e87301bb5b9133396d72ee1f4f95032e9b76f0c84a984f6814e81c8dfed11:0
- value
- 5213226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1282eb0d5c6ff076b2538aaaef7825cf9f6c0321 OP_EQUAL
- address
- 33NtvMJMwKDY4me1bvMiB7d3FVKnHJWoWr